Available mesh grades Ultra-Clear® is available in multiple particle-size ranges for different treatment configurations, filtration equipment and hydraulic requirements. Grade Relative particle size Typical starting fit Key considerations 8/16 mesh Coarse Retained-bed and coarse-media treatment configurations Bed retention, flow, contact time, vessel design and pressure drop 16/30 mesh Coarse to intermediate Retained-media and compatible granular treatment systems Screen retention, hydraulics, contaminant loading and contact 30/60 mesh Intermediate to fine Contact treatment and filtration using smaller granular media Contact area, filtration rate, downstream retention and cake behavior 60/90 mesh Fine Finer treatment and filtration systems with controlled media retention Fine-particle retention, pressure drop, filtration and handling Mesh size is not a performance ranking. Finer grades provide greater available contact area but can also increase pressure drop and downstream retention requirements. Grade selection should match both the purification objective and the physical treatment system. For a detailed particle-size selection matrix, see Ultra-Clear particle sizes for jet fuel treatment . How Ultra-Clear fits the treatment process Process factor Why it matters Contaminant profile Attapulgite should be qualified against the actual compound or fuel-quality issue being targeted. Particle size Mesh range influences retention, available contact area, flow and pressure drop. Contact method Retained-bed and contact-treatment systems impose different requirements on media size and downstream filtration. Flow rate Hydraulic loading affects residence time, pressure drop and interaction between the liquid and treatment media. Media loading Available treatment capacity and contaminant loading influence cycle life and replacement frequency. Finished-product requirement Performance should be evaluated against measurable process or fuel-quality requirements rather than visual clarification alone. Evaluating attapulgite outside jet fuel? Typical properties Product family Clarification and purification media Base material Attapulgite-type clay Form Granular clarification media Appearance Gray to tan Free moisture Approximately 1.0% typical; 3.0% maximum lot specification for Ultra-Clear® 30/60 pH 6.7 typical, measured at 5% solids in deionized water Tamped density Approximately 31–32 lb/ft³ (497–513 kg/m³), depending on mesh grade Relative density 2.2 Water solubility Insoluble Flammability Unused product is not flammable Manufacturer Oil-Dri Corporation of America Values shown are typical or published reference values and are not absolute specifications. Lot-specific results may be confirmed through a Certificate of Analysis. Quality assurance Ultra-Clear® is manufactured under Oil-Dri's quality assurance program. Depending on grade, lot testing may include: Bulk density Free moisture Particle-size distribution Microseparometer performance testing Lot-specific Certificates of Analysis are available upon request for qualifying orders. Which Ultra-Clear mesh size should I choose? The appropriate mesh depends on the treatment configuration, filtration equipment, required media retention, flow rate, allowable pressure drop, contaminant profile and contact requirements. Finer media is not automatically better. What is the difference between Ultra-Clear 8/16, 16/30, 30/60 and 60/90? The primary difference is particle-size range. Coarser grades are generally easier to retain in granular treatment systems, while finer grades provide greater available contact area but require tighter media retention and may increase pressure drop. Can Ultra-Clear be used in a retained or fixed bed? Coarser granular grades may fit retained-bed treatment configurations where the media remains physically contained while the process liquid passes through. Vessel design, screens, flow, contact time and pressure drop should be evaluated for the actual system. What package sizes are available?
